  1. Apothecary Restaurant in Santa Fe Plaza has been my absolute favorite gluten free restaurant in Santa Fe. My boyfriend and I happened upon this place when we were out one afternoon and saw it was gluten-free AND dog friendly! 

We decided to go back for dinner that same night. When we sat down at our table, we received an envelope of menu cards, like tarot cards. Initially I was a bit intimidated. The owner, Kadimah, told us to see what spoke to us from the menu. 

Since the entire menu was gluten-free, I had no restrictions on what I could order. We started with the Artichoke Brulee which was divine! Then we got the rosemary fries and a yucca crust pizza. Everything was so fresh and flavorful, we savored every bite. We shared the salmon and couldn’t finish it so we brought it home for lunch the next day.

The drinks were unlike anything I’ve ever tried. I had a Blueberry Lavender Coconut Kava which was like drinking luxury. It was the best thing I have ever had to drink. Larry had a warm elixir called Elder Toddie. I cannot say enough good things about these drinks! They were remarkable!

  1. Tune Up Cafe is in the same neighborhood as my Airbnb. It is the proverbial neighborhood restaurant, and the food is interesting and remarkable! There are no frills and the wine is served in a juice glass and the food will wow you! If you go, please try the Mole Colorado. It was such a unique dish with a grilled banana on top! 

They have a lot of gluten-free options on their menu, but my favorite part is the gluten-free dessert menu. The Lemon Custard Cake with toasted coconut is fantastic and they have weekly pie specials that are gluten-free as well.

  1. Radish and Rye is an upscale gluten free restaurant in Santa Fe, located right on Cerrillos Road. They offer farm inspired cuisine that is locally sourced, when possible. They don’t have a gluten free menu but the chef is gluten free so a lot of the menu options are gluten free. 

Their drinks are innovative and the bartenders have fun with the patrons. If you are not riding solo as I am, make reservations as they fill up fast! 

I sat at the bar and met some lovely locals and enjoyed the brussel sprouts and pulled pork croquettes. Really flavorful dishes and a very local, friendly bar!

  1. Santa Fe School of Cooking is a great place to spend a weekend morning. My mom and I participated in a Southwestern Appetizer class. We learned about the food that was being prepared and a bit of the history of the ingredients. And then we ate a yummy meal with new friends. **You can let the staff know when you book the class about food allergies.
  1. La Boca is a Tapas restaurant serving unique one serving dishes that are too good not to share! The chef does an amazing job combining Spanish and Mediterranean flavors into incredible tapas. 

I am still dreaming about the alcachofas (you just have to try it) and he was able to make bruschetta on gluten free bread which was excellent. Most of the menu can accomodate gluten free. There was a live musician playing the night I was there and that added to the amazing food and atmosphere.  

  1. Sazon is very high end and it’s on Shelby St (my daughter’s name) so I was excited to try it out. A lot of the menu is gluten free and the staff is great about substitutions when requested. The Mole’ is exceptional and the list of tequila is impressive! 

“Chef Olea creates sophisticated flavors using Old Mexico’s indigenous and culinary traditions alongside ingredients from around the world”

  1. Joseph’s – Duck Fat Chips! Joesph’s place is quaint and unassuming and the dining options will wow you. Many of the items on the menu are gluten free, and you can even get gluten free bread! 
  1. Vinaigrette – located on Don Cubero Alley. This small chain offers amazing salads with a unique twist with great add-ons. They don’t have a gluten free menu but the staff is knowledgeable and very  accommodating so they can let you know what to avoid with allergies. 
  1. Sweetwater Harvest Kitchen was recommended by my hairstylist who is in the same plaza. She mentioned that it was all gluten free. I was delighted to try this wonderful spot. The atmosphere is like spring and their menu did not disappoint. The Hunter’s Chicken is an incredible choice. It is full of flavor served with sauteed’ kale and potatoes. 

I can’t forget to mention that the entire dessert menu is gluten free!

  1. Counter Culture was also recommended by my hairstylist (I was there for a LONG time!) This gluten free restaurant serves lunch and dinner. They have gluten free bread for all of their sandwiches. Great place to get a cup of coffee, breakfast or lunch. 
  1. Cafe Pasquels is located on the Plaza so it’s a perfect place to stop for lunch while you’re out shopping. Several menu items were gluten free but I had to try the flan, so I made that my lunch!
